Eskom dollar bonds fall

Eskom’s dollar bonds dropped to nearly 14-month lows on Monday as the South African state power firm resumed nationwide power cuts.

The company’s August 2028 issue slipped 4.6 cents to 100.5 cents on the dollar, its lowest level since January 2019, while the August 2023 issue shed 3 cents, according to Tradeweb data.

Eskom resumed nationwide power cuts on Monday, cutting up to 1,000 megawatts (MW) from the grid due to unplanned breakdowns of generating units.

The power cuts, which may last until Thursday, will end at 11 p.m on Monday.
